Understanding the Importance of Data Governance in Modern Business
Data governance refers to the comprehensive set of policies, procedures, standards, and responsibilities that ensure data is managed effectively across an organization. It guarantees that data is accurate, accessible, consistent, and secure. Proper data governance enhances decision-making, reduces risks, and promotes trust among stakeholders.
For businesses providing IT services & computer repair and data recovery, having robust data governance practices means they can deliver reliable solutions, promote customer confidence, and stay compliant with industry regulations such as GDPR, HIPAA, and CCPA. These practices also help in mitigating data breaches and minimizing downtime caused by data mishandling or corruption.
Core Components of Data Governance Best Practices
Implementing effective data governance encompasses several critical components:
- Data Quality Management: Ensuring data accuracy, completeness, and consistency.
- Data Security and Privacy: Protecting sensitive information against unauthorized access and breaches.
- Data Compliance: Adhering to relevant legal and regulatory standards.
- Data Lifecycle Management: Managing data from creation to deletion efficiently.
- Roles and Responsibilities: Defining clear accountability for data management tasks.
- Data Auditing and Monitoring: Regularly reviewing data practices for compliance and effectiveness.
- Technology and Tools: Utilizing state-of-the-art solutions to support data governance efforts.
Implementing Data Governance Best Practices in Your Business
Putting data governance best practices into action involves strategic planning, organization-wide commitment, and continuous improvement. Here are key steps to successfully embed these practices within your company's operations:
1. Conduct a Comprehensive Data Assessment
Start by evaluating your current data landscape. Identify types of data handled, storage locations, access controls, and existing management procedures. This assessment provides a baseline to develop targeted governance policies tailored to your organizational needs.
2. Define Clear Data Policies and Standards
Develop formal policies that specify how data is collected, stored, accessed, shared, and deleted. Establish standards for data quality, security protocols, and privacy practices to ensure consistency across all teams.
3. Assign Roles and Responsibilities
Effective data governance relies on clear accountability. Designate data owners, stewards, and users with defined roles. For example, a Chief Data Officer (CDO) may oversee overall governance, while data stewards manage day-to-day data quality and compliance.
4. Invest in Robust Data Management Tools
Leverage advanced technology solutions—such as data cataloging, classification, and encryption tools—to support governance goals. These tools streamline data inventory, monitor access, and facilitate compliance reporting.
5. Establish Data Security Measures
Implement strict access controls, encryption, regular audits, and real-time monitoring to safeguard data assets. Promoting a culture of security awareness among staff minimizes human error and insider threats.
6. Regular Training and Awareness
Educate all employees involved in data handling about best practices, organizational policies, and the importance of data integrity and security. Ongoing training ensures everyone is aligned with governance objectives.
7. Continuous Monitoring and Improvement
Establish routines for periodic audits, compliance checks, and feedback loops. Use analytics to identify vulnerabilities, inefficiencies, or breaches promptly, enabling rapid response and refinement of policies.

Future Trends in Data Governance
The landscape of data governance is continually evolving, driven by technological advancements and regulatory shifts. Staying ahead involves understanding upcoming trends:
-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ning: Automating data classification, anomaly detection, and risk assessments.
- Real-time Data Governance: Implementing policies that monitor and enforce governance automatically in real-time.
- Data Privacy by Design: Embedding privacy measures from the outset of data collection and processing.
- Increased Regulatory Complexity: Navigating new laws such as the California Privacy Rights Act (CPRA) and global privacy standards.
- Data Literacy Initiatives: Promoting a culture where all employees are educated on data importance and best practices.
